What are some alternatives?

When comparing gopass and LessPass, you can also consider the following products

KeePass - KeePass is an open source password manager. Passwords can be stored in highly-encrypted databases, which can be unlocked with one master password or key file.

bitwarden - Bitwarden is a free and open source password management solution for individuals, teams, and business organizations.

Lastpass - LastPass is an online password manager and form filler that makes web browsing easier and more secure.

1Password - 1Password can create strong, unique passwords for you, remember them, and restore them, all directly in your web browser.

Dashlane - Dashlane is a secure way to bypass tedious logins, forms, and purchases online. Save all of your information and save time in your online transactions.

Padlock - Padlock is an open-source password manager that is available as an app for multiple platforms. It can be used on Android and iOS devices, and it can also be installed as a Chrome extension.
